The study of the way people work is known as organizational behavior. This field examines how individuals and groups interact within an organization, exploring factors such as motivation, leadership, team dynamics, and workplace culture. Understanding these elements helps improve productivity, employee satisfaction, and overall organizational effectiveness.

Actually it's the other way around. You require different compilers for different operating systems. The reason for this is that an operating system is basically an intermediate step for a person to be able to interact with the hardware on their system. Each OS has a different way to do this, and so compilers must be different for each one, even for the same language.

The study of the way organisms interact with their environment is called ecology. It examines how living organisms, including humans, interact with each other and their surroundings, as well as how they adapt to their environment.

Operating systems are software written to provide a way to manage system resources and to provide a interface for the user to interact with and operate the computer.
